The
process is simple. You meet with a loan officer who completes the
home loan application that includes pulling the credit report and
taking copies of all of the required documentation. The loan amount
is then determined and the loan package is submitted for pre-approval.
Once the pre-approval is obtained, you then meet with your real
estate agent to locate a desired property.
Once you have located the property and an offer is accepted by the
seller, the realtor forwards the Purchase and Sales Agreement (P&SA)
to Admiral Mortgage.
When received, the Processor places orders for title, appraisal,
and sets up escrow. All documents are gathered and submitted to
underwriting for approval and final closing conditions.
The Processor receives the final documents and closing conditions
from the underwriter. The Processor then gathers final closing documents
and resubmits them to underwriting for final approval.
Upon receiving final approval, closing documents are ordered and
sent to escrow.
Escrow clears title, prepares final documents, brings in buyer for
signing, and forwards these documents to the investor for acceptance
and loan funding.
